The LT4 was an engine option for the 1996 Corvette, available with a manual 6 speed Trans only. SLP built some 1996 Pontiac Firehawks (Firebirds) with the LT4 engines, put them together for GM.

I don't know how many of you have read the new AHFS since it was updated but here is the line from it.

In addition, the engine family must NOT make two runs of 0.650 or quicker or any run 0.850 or quicker during the past two (2) review periods, for the review to continue. Once an engine family receives a horsepower increase it is not eligible for a decrease.


I think this means you will never get hp off after a hit. how far back are they going to go, when you got Hp, I dont know where the line in the sand is, may depend on who you are? correct me if I am wrong.
